Ancelotti’s Final Countdown

Milan boss Carlo Ancelotti has warned semi-final opponents Roma that reaching the Coppa Italia Final is a major objective.

The Rossoneri welcome the capital giants to the San Siro for the first leg on Thursday and Ancelotti is looking forward to the challenge which the Giallorossi will present them.

“First of all, we can talk about anything except Massimo Oddo, Ronaldo or tomorrow’s starting line-up,” joked Ancelotti as the pre-match Press conference kicked-off.

“The semi-final will be very interesting because we will face a very strong team, one who defeated us in the championship.

“We are also approaching the first objective of the season. Christian Panucci said that Roma want to reach the Final, but so do we!

“We have recovered some of our injured players and we have obtained some good results, considering the fact that we played two delicate games against Fiorentina and Lazio recently.”

Ancelotti admitted that he will field an attacking formation which will include Ricardo Oliveira, who has been linked with a move given his disappointing performances since his summer arrival.

“We will play with three forwards,” noted the tactician. “I believe this game can be a good opportunity for Oliveira’s comeback.

“He is doing well in training, but is having some difficulty in games.”

Ancelotti finally commented on Valon Behrami’s dangerous challenge on Alberto Gilardino during the match against Lazio at the weekend.

“It was the only mistake in a game where the referee did well. It was a very bad foul, but I believe it was due to tiredness and not because of a desire to injure someone.

“It’s not always easy to be objective with fouls. It’s possible to change your opinion on them once you see them on television.”

Football Italia
